Yeah, I think I'd be tempted to coat the foundation wall with Drylock...


...and then frame a new wall proud of the foundation wall with an air gap in between. You could probably get away with faced insulation in the stud cavities, but you could also do an entire vapor barrier as Tuckahokie said. Then hang sheetrock on the face of the framing. but that's definitely a more costly and involved process.
